多台客户端连接同一个服务器,高效管理多客户端连接同一服务器数据库的策略与实践
- 综合资讯
- 2025-04-09 03:44:00
- 3

本文探讨了多客户端连接同一服务器数据库的高效管理策略与实践,针对数据库连接管理、并发控制和性能优化等方面进行深入分析,提出了一套适用于多客户端环境下的数据库连接管理方案...
本文探讨了多客户端连接同一服务器数据库的高效管理策略与实践,针对数据库连接管理、并发控制和性能优化等方面进行深入分析,提出了一套适用于多客户端环境下的数据库连接管理方案。
随着互联网技术的飞速发展,越来越多的企业和组织开始采用数据库来存储和管理大量数据,在实际应用中,如何有效地管理多客户端连接同一服务器数据库,成为了一个亟待解决的问题,本文将针对这一问题,从以下几个方面进行探讨:数据库架构设计、连接策略优化、性能监控与调优。
数据库架构设计
图片来源于网络,如有侵权联系删除
分布式数据库架构
分布式数据库架构可以将数据分散存储在多个服务器上,通过分布式技术实现数据的并行处理和负载均衡,这种架构可以有效提高数据库的并发处理能力和扩展性,适用于处理大量数据和高并发访问的场景。
主从复制架构
主从复制架构是指在多个服务器之间实现数据同步,主服务器负责数据写入,从服务器负责数据读取,这种架构可以降低单点故障风险,提高系统的可用性和可靠性。
分区表架构
分区表架构将数据按照一定规则进行分区,每个分区存储一部分数据,这种架构可以提高查询效率,降低数据维护成本,适用于处理大量数据和高并发访问的场景。
连接策略优化
连接池技术
连接池技术可以将多个数据库连接复用,减少连接创建和销毁的开销,在多客户端连接场景下,合理配置连接池参数,如连接数、最大等待时间等,可以有效提高数据库访问效率。
连接串行化
在多客户端连接场景下,为了防止数据竞争和保证数据一致性,可以采用连接串行化技术,该技术通过限制同一时间只有一个客户端可以访问数据库,从而保证数据的一致性和完整性。
负载均衡
图片来源于网络,如有侵权联系删除
负载均衡可以将客户端请求分配到不同的服务器上,实现分布式数据库架构的负载均衡,在多客户端连接场景下,合理配置负载均衡策略,如轮询、最少连接数等,可以提高数据库的并发处理能力和系统稳定性。
性能监控与调优
监控工具
选择合适的监控工具对数据库进行实时监控,可以及时发现性能瓶颈和潜在问题,常见的监控工具包括:Nagios、Zabbix、Prometheus等。
性能调优
针对数据库性能瓶颈,可以从以下几个方面进行调优:
(1)优化SQL语句:通过分析查询计划,优化SQL语句,减少查询时间和资源消耗。
(2)索引优化:合理设计索引,提高查询效率。
(3)内存优化:调整数据库参数,优化内存使用。
(4)磁盘I/O优化:优化磁盘读写性能,提高数据库访问速度。
多客户端连接同一服务器数据库是一个复杂且具有挑战性的问题,通过合理的数据库架构设计、连接策略优化、性能监控与调优,可以有效提高数据库的并发处理能力和系统稳定性,在实际应用中,需要根据具体场景和需求,选择合适的方案,以达到最佳效果。
本文链接:https://www.zhitaoyun.cn/2047144.html
发表评论